United Nigeria Airlines has finally addressed the viral altercation between controversial social critic VeryDarkMan (Martins Vincent Otse) and comedian Mr Jollof (Freedom Atsepoyi), which erupted during boarding at the Asaba International Airport.

A trending video earlier showed both men in a heated confrontation aboard a flight, though details were unclear. In a newly released statement posted on the airline’s official X account and signed by Public Relations Officer Chibuike Uloka, the incident was confirmed to have occurred on November 17, 2025, during the boarding of Flight UN0523.

According to the airline, crew members intervened immediately in line with global aviation safety standards and both passengers were deboarded without delay.

The Statement partly reads:

“In full compliance with global aviation safety protocols, our crew responded immediately and professionally to de-escalate the situation. Both passengers were deboarded without delay to ensure the safety, comfort, and security of all other passengers and crew members.

They were subsequently handed over to airport security for further investigation.

United Nigeria Airlines places the highest priority on safety and maintains a zero-tolerance policy for any conduct that threatens the security or well-being of passengers or crew.

After all standard procedures were completed, the flight departed safely while the passengers involved in the altercation remained with the authorities.”

The airline reaffirmed its commitment to maintaining a safe and respectful travel environment across its network.

The official statement was also shared on social media by the airline.
